    A decent little dive, with cheap beer served cold. Though at the time of our visit, the patrons and bartender seemed to be suspicious of us outsiders and weren't very sociable with us compared to most other bars I've been to. The bar is across the street from a skate park and apparently they have a lot of problems with thirsty kids coming in for something to drink. A sign warned them that if they are only getting water then they need to bring their own cups.

    Great place for Breakfast! My wife and I had just got into town. We went to another place first, but were turned away because we were a few minutes past when they stopped serving. Then we remembered that a friend had recommended the Depot. We have no problems eating in bars, but be warned... This is a Bar. However, having said that, the food was really good, the silver and dishes were clean and the Coffee was hot. Our server was friendly, but aren't all bartenders? Currently, this may be the only place to eat a late morning Breakfast in Richmond. In any case, this is definitely our Breakfast place from now on.

    Monday, I was driving around Richmond, MO to find a place to have lunch that wasn't fast food. What's wrong with this town? Out of the 2 "restaurants", one was closed on Mondays and the other had gone out of business. So I tried Depot Tavern. I have had bfast there but not lunch. I must say that the Depot Burger, curly fries and jalapeño poppers were quite tasty. The hamburger was NOT one of those preformed cardboard patties. And Mary, the cook, didn't overcook the poppers. Kudos Mary! I've eaten their Tenderloins before, which are really good, so this was a nice change. Even though it's a Tavern, I would recommend this place. Mainly cuz they're open Monday thru Saturday for Bfast, Lunch & Dinner and the staff is friendly.

    This would be considered a dive bar by most peoples standards but it's just a small town bar in a…read morereally small town outside of Pleasant Hii Mo on 58 Hiway. For what it is I should have given it 5 stars. The food is excellent the atmosphere is friendly with old mismatched chairs and tables, clean but old and small restrooms. A couple flat screens and pool tables. The crowd is typical small town locals, farmers and blue collar guys which I fit into pretty well. Friday and Saturday they have steaks and shrimp and during the week your typical bar food. However far from typical in taste. Everything is fresh nothing frozen. Big burgers cooked on a flat top along with fresh huge lightly breaded Tenderloins, perfectly cooked traditional wings and a giant Philly steak made out of sliced ribeye that is really hard to eat all of it at once. 1.50-2.00 16oz draws and a few different domestic bottles as well as mixed drinks. Smoking allowed but it's never been overpowering and I've been in several times. This is the best place in the surrounding area to eat hands down and worth the trip if your out driving around east of Lees Summit. Highly recommend the Philly, wings and the Tenderloin but everything is good
